BETHEL — With 17 seniors out of 43 receiving a 3.3 or higher grade point average, Telstar High School Class of 2025, has recorded it’s highest number of Latin Scholars ever, according to Principal John Eliot, who added there were just eight last year.

“This is an impressive feat for the Class of 2025, as it represents the most seniors recognized under the Latin Honors system since THS switched from the traditional Top 10 recognition.” The change occurred several years ago, before Kenney’s former tenure as principal.

“This class has been very academically competitive and driven since they entered as ninth graders.  There is a lot to be proud of and celebrate here!” said Maine School Administrative District-44 Superintendent of Schools, Mark Kenney.

Telstar students come from Bethel, and the surrounding towns of: Andover, Woodstock, Newry, Gilead and Greenwood.

The seventeen students who have achieved either Magna Cum Laude or Summa Cum Laude status are: Valedictorian Ella Akers; Salutatorian Gabrielle Thompson; Third Honors Kayan DeGruttola; Ella Hopps; Lily Souther; Jocelyn Nivus; Kylie Friel, Rylee Cooper; Hayley Smith; Hunter Winslow; Emma Newell, Katherine Devaney; Wylie Williamson, Brody Morgan Katalina Hart; Timothy Wakefield and Grady Kellogg.
